34jzgte
24-08-2011, 05:02 PM
Comin along awesome man, last time I seen it was when it was 1/3 done and you were lookin to sell on pub and gumtree. I did consider contacting you about itbthen but was unable to.
I hope one day to make my own streetfighter from an old air cooler gsxr1100. One day I will. I assume your on all the auusie street fighter forums? Some of the US and German ones are so out there would be instant cop bait in Oz.

Yeah i almost would have sold it but in the end i decided to just finish it and ride it around, yeah i am on there look in the your ride section under zx7 my first project i think, you can get away with the high tail if you have a fender there, im going to bend the number plate in the 45" area of the wheel and it will be compliant for the 45 rule, i have another fighter project quite possibly in the making.


So good Marco, more of an accomplishment that you took the time to do it yourself!

Some day soon your going to have the most ridiculous collection of toys out... and after all, he who dies with the most toys, wins.

Haha thanks man, in a few weeks ill be on the road so let me know if your keen on a ride.


came into this thread thinking i'd see some shit 'streetfighter' job. (crashed bike. naked. new headlight. risers)

but you have done some cool shit.

fibreglassing work is tops! well done.

Thanks, the true streetfighters are customized sports bikes and the like, the other kind would be just known as a naked bike.


You don't do things by halves. Very jealous of what the end result will be.

Its all about the time you spend doing things like this i guess and not minding that its not on the road for some time, same as the supra i could work on that while trying to keep it drive-able but then short cuts are taken to meet deadlines.
Im trying to come up with a color scheme atm, possible blood orange with some cool graphics, or keep it anthracite color.
